Understanding the Mechanics of Jail Population Data

To make sense of the Muskingum County Jail Population: Insights into Inmate Demographics and Trends, it is helpful to understand how this data is collected and analyzed. Jails typically house individuals who have been arrested and are awaiting trial, as well as those serving short sentences for misdemeanors. Demographic data is gathered through intake interviews, booking forms, and facility logs. This information is then categorized by factors such as age, gender, race, and the nature of the alleged offense. For example, a report might reveal that a majority of the population is between the ages of 25 and 44, or that certain non-violent offenses represent a significant portion of admissions. These statistics are updated regularly and are often reviewed by oversight boards, legislators, and advocacy groups to identify patterns and potential areas for reform.

Clarifying Common Misunderstandings

One widespread misconception is that the jail population reflects the overall crime rate in a community. In reality, arrest rates, prosecution policies, and bail conditions heavily influence who ends up behind bars. Another myth is that demographic data points to inherent criminality within certain groups. Responsible analysis looks at systemic factors, such as poverty, lack of access to education, and neighborhood policing tactics, rather than personal character.
